Title
The effects of animal-assisted therapy on loneliness in an elderly population in long-term care facilities.
Authors
Banks, Marian R; Banks, William A
Abstract
Animal-assisted therapy (AAT) is claimed to have a variety of benefits, but almost all published results are anecdotal. We characterized the resident population in long-term care facilities desiring AAT and determined whether AAT can objectively improve loneliness.
Publication
The journals of gerontology. Series A, Biological sciences and medical sciences, 2002, Vol 57, Issue 7, pM428
